Weekly Photo Challenge: Friendship

Brothers In Arms

It took a little longer than I had thought it would to get a shot for this weeks challenge, but I am glad I waited.  These two boys were enjoying each others company so much while waiting for their mom to come from the snack shack.  I watched at least 4 hugs happen between them, as the younger boy really looked up to his big brother. It was very touching, because at some point the dynamic will likely change as it has with my own boys.  While they get along well, when they do get along, the times are few and far between and I am more often then not breaking up fights.  Still, knowing how my relationship with my own brothers has become more like friends, the outlook isn’t quite so bad.  June 14, 2012
